Aviation Engine MRO Market – Driving Operational Efficiency Through Technology
Aircraft engine reliability is essential for safe and efficient flight operations. Maintenance, Repair, and Overhaul (MRO) services ensure engines operate at peak performance, minimize downtime, and comply with aviation regulations. The integration of digital monitoring, AI diagnostics, and predictive analytics has revolutionized traditional engine maintenance practices.
The Aviation Engine MRO Market is expanding due to increased adoption of technology-driven maintenance solutions. Predictive maintenance allows early detection of engine faults, reducing operational disruptions and improving flight safety. MRO services include component replacement, inspections, overhauls, and testing, all designed to optimize engine performance and reliability.
Market Trends
Significant industry trends include the adoption of AI-powered diagnostics, cloud-based monitoring, and automated inspection systems. These solutions enhance accuracy, reduce errors, and shorten maintenance cycles. Advanced materials and repair methods, such as additive manufacturing, allow for durable component replacements and efficient overhauls.
Remote monitoring and IoT integration provide real-time performance data, enabling proactive maintenance and efficient resource allocation. Standardized processes across MRO facilities enhance consistency and operational reliability.
